Project Description

- Using Movie Maker, make a VJ (Video Jockey) Movie

 

You will be creating a Movie we could play at the beginning of chapel when students are coming into the theatre. You will be the actors (VJ) introducing 3 music videos already made from last year.

 

In groups of 2, you will use 3 music videos that were created last year. You will create a Much Music Video Jockey session. You must become the characters to introduce these videos that you will be playing. VJ also give interesting information about the artist sing the song or discuss and issue that’s relevant to our world. They make it interesting. You might talk about GCA events and happenings, etc...

 

This project is learned through inquiry* and I (Mr. Schellenberg) am a resources for you.

   
 

Part A

  1. Choose a partner
  2. Choose 3 Video’s from those created last year
  3. Begin working on a 4 scripts:
    1. First, to start the first video
    2. 2nd, to end the first video and start the 2nd video
    3. 3rd, to end the 2nd video and start the 3rd video
    4. 4th, to end the 3rd video and end the show
   
 

Part B

  1. Go to the following link with your partner and learn about how to make better videos
  2. Record the 4 video skits
   
 

Part C

  1. Put the music videos together with the videos you made into Movie Maker
  2. You must have an 8 second introduction slide
  3. Must have introduction credits
  4. Must have closing credits

Rubric 

Category

4

3

2

1

Total

Points

Presentation

Holds Audience attention well the entire time.  Exciting to watch.

Holds Audience attention most of the time.  Some sections are hard to follow.

Holds Audience attention for some of the time but for the most part is difficult to follow.

Audience attention is lost shortly into the movie.

 

Originality

Movie shows a lot of original thought.  Ideas are creative and inventive.

Product shows some original thought. Work shows new ideas and insights

Uses other people’s ideas (giving them credit), but there is little evidence of original thinking.

Uses other people’s ideas and doesn’t give them credit.

 

Pictures & Style

Makes excellent use of font, color, graphics, effects etc. to enhance the presentation.

Makes good use of font, color, graphics, effects, etc. to enhance the presentation

Makes use of font, color, graphics, effects, etc. but occasionally these detract from the presentation content.

Use of font, color, graphics, effects, etc. but these often  detract from the presentation content

 

Flow

Movie moves nicely, theme is easily identified, audience displayed appreciation for the production

With a bit more editing and better clips selection, use of transition, etc. movie would be excellent.

Movie was nothing more than a series of clips joined together. Could have been created by turning the camera off and on.

There was no movie.

 

Mechanics

No misspelling, effects work well, music is well chosen and transitions are very smooth.

1 misspelled word; effects are work but are a little choppy.  Music fits the movie and transitions are smooth.

2 misspelled words; effects don’t work.  Music progresses poorly and transitions are abrupt.

More than 2 misspelled words; no effects, poorly chosen music with no relevance.

 

Minimum Requirements

Meets and exceeds minimum requirements.

Meets minimum requirements with no effort to above and beyond.

Missing more than 2 minimum requirements.

Missing more than 4 of the minimum requirements.

 

Use of Time

Excellent us of time

Very good use of time.

Satisfactory use of time.

Poor use of time.
